Transaction 0809a84be83763029f7a1097d88891274012291fdae629673be1af44b57d99f1

1 Input
2 Outputs
  • 0809a84be83763029f7a1097d88891274012291fdae629673be1af44b57d99f1:0
  • value  15463774
    address  3CjZP56vJ7kqKk7RuhFMn39jFe8hb38HW3
  • 0809a84be83763029f7a1097d88891274012291fdae629673be1af44b57d99f1:1
  • value  503348
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c